중온수 흡수식 냉동기용 유하 액막식 재생기의 전열관 성능 특성에 관한 연구
이준하(Joon-Ha Lee),김병련(Beyung-Leyean Kim),이광표(Gwang-Pyo Lee),박찬우(Chan-Woo Park) 대한기계학회 2013 대한기계학회 춘추학술대회 Vol.2013 No.12
The objective of this study is to investigate the changes of the performance of a hot water absorption chiller as influenced by the characteristics of the heating tubes inserted in its generator. The absorbent and the refrigerant flowing inside the generator are LiBr and water, respectively. The experiments were done based on a 58% absorbent concentration. In the experiments, the inlet and outlet temperatures of the absorbent and the inlet and outlet temperature of the refrigerant in the generator are measured. Also, the pressure of the generator and the flow rate of the refrigerant and the absorbent we measured. A Labview program was used for the measurements. Tests were conducted on different types of heating tubes using the same experimental conditions and the values of the overall heat transfer coefficient are determined. With this, the type of heating tubes that results to the improvement of the performance of the absorption chiller can be identified.
흡수식 냉동기용 만액식 재생기와 유하 액막식 재생기의 성능 비교 특성 연구
이준하(Joon-Ha Lee),김대해(Dae-Hae Kim),김병련(Beyung-Leyean Kim),박찬우(Chan-Woo Park) 대한설비공학회 2013 대한설비공학회 학술발표대회논문집 Vol.2013 No.6
The object of study is to investigate the performance comparison with falling film and pool boiling generator in absorption chiller as influenced by the types of the heating tubes. The absorbent and refrigerant flowing inside the generator are LiBr and water, respectively. The experiments were done based on a 55% absorbent concentration. In the experiments, the parameters are temperatures and flow rate at the inlet and outlet of the refrigerant and absorbent. A Labview program was used for the measurements. For the purposes of this study, the parameters in the falling film and pool boiling generator test are tested at the same experimental conditions, we tried to compare with and improve of the performance of falling film and pool boiling generator on some types of heating tubes.
